...idea it played this role, says Dr. Saul Malozowski, a senior endocrinologist at the National Institute of Diabetes and Digestive and Kidney Disorders. "The skeleton used to be thought of as just a structural support system. This opens the door to a new way of seeing the bones." The finding parallels discoveries in the 1990s about the metabolic activities of fat - another body tissue that was once seen as inert...
